Responsibilities

  • Serves as an Instructor in the CYS Instructional Program. Provides individual and/or group lessons to participants. Offers less structured activities for parents/children.
  • Coordinates work schedules with Instructional Program Specialist. Develops individual and group lesson plans. Tracks participant's accomplishments, long and short term goals, effort, and evaluations as appropriate for age and type of instruction.
  • Maintains control of and accounts for whereabouts and safety of program participants. Observes and evaluates participants developmental level and records progress.
  • Continually reviews instructional sessions and plans for appropriateness. Observes program participants for signs that may indicate illness, abuse or neglect and reports as directed.
  • Plans and conducts special events for parents designed to promote the instructional program while encouraging parents to become involved.

Qualifications

1. Possess a high school diploma or GED certificate.
2. Be able to communicate in English (both written and verbal).
3. Be 18 years of age at the time of appointment.
4. Possess and maintain the physical ability to lift and carry up to 40 lbs, walk, bend, stoop and stand on a routine basis. Duties
may involve working both indoors and outdoors.
5. Possess and maintain health and freedom from communicable disease.
6. Demonstrated skill/evidence of competence in music.

Preferred are those candidates who possess a Professional Certificates/Credentials; or Associates Degree or higher with 15
semester hours of college credit in Music, Music Theory, Piano.

Highly Preferred: Candidates who possess a Professional Certificates/Credentials; or Associates Degree or higher with 15 semester hours of college credit in music/music theory/piano.
